Ingredients for Buffalo Chicken Sliders
When you think of a game day snack or a simple weeknight dinner, Buffalo chicken sliders hit the spot! Here's what you need to whip up these delicious bites:
- 12-ounce package Hawaiian sweet dinner rolls: Look for brands like King’s Hawaiian for that perfect sweetness!
- 3 cups shredded chicken breast: About 8 ounces of cooked chicken will do. If you're unsure how to cook it, check out this guide on cooking shredded chicken.
- ¾ cup hot sauce: Frank’s RedHot or Frank’s Buffalo are two fantastic options to bring the heat.
- ¼ cup ranch dressing: A Greek-yogurt-based version keeps it light and tangy.
- 1 teaspoon garlic powder: For that extra punch of flavor.
- 2 cups shredded mozzarella cheese: You can mix it up with provolone or Havarti if you're feeling adventurous.
- 3 tablespoons unsalted butter: Melted to add richness.
- 1 teaspoon Italian seasoning: This gives a wonderful depth of flavor.

Mix the Buffalo chicken filling
In a mixing bowl, combine the shredded chicken, hot sauce, ranch dressing, and garlic powder. Ensure everything is well mixed; you want your chicken to be evenly coated in that delicious spicy sauce. Taste a little of the filling—because who can resist the burst of flavor? This mixture is where your sliders will get their fantastic taste.
Assemble the sliders
Now that your filling is ready, it's time to put everything together. Without separating the buns, slice them horizontally to create a top and bottom. Place the bottom half in the center of a lined baking sheet.
- Sprinkle a small handful of shredded mozzarella cheese evenly over the bottom half.
- Add a generous amount of your Buffalo chicken mixture on top.
- Follow with another layer of shredded cheese over the chicken.
Carefully place the top bun over your cheesy, saucy delight.
Brush and bake the sliders
This part is where the magic happens! In a small bowl, mix the melted butter and Italian seasoning. Brush this mixture liberally over the top of the buns. This gives them a lovely golden color while baking.
Pop your sliders into a preheated oven at 375°F. Bake for about 10 to 12 minutes or until the cheese is melty and bubbling, and the tops are a beautiful golden brown.
Cool, slice, and serve
Once your sliders are out of the oven, allow them to cool for a few minutes—this will also help the cheese set slightly. With a serrated knife, carefully slice apart the sliders. Serve immediately and watch them disappear!

Spicy Buffalo Chicken Sliders
If you're craving an extra kick, try adding crushed red pepper flakes or a splash of cayenne pepper to your buffalo chicken mixture. This creates a flavorful punch that elevates the heat. You could even include jalapeños for that fresh crunch!
Vegetarian Buffalo Sliders with Cauliflower
For a vegetarian alternative, replace the chicken with roasted cauliflower. Simply toss cauliflower florets in hot sauce, roast them until crispy, and layer them between your sweet buns. Drizzle with ranch dressing or blue cheese for that classic buffalo flavor. It's a satisfying option that even meat lovers will enjoy.

Can I use rotisserie chicken for this recipe?
Absolutely! Using rotisserie chicken can save you time in the kitchen. Just shred the chicken and mix it with your favorite hot sauce, ranch dressing, and spices for that deliciously bold flavor. Plus, it's a great way to use leftovers from a previous meal!
What’s the best way to store leftovers?
To keep your Buffalo Chicken Sliders fresh, wrap any leftovers in foil and refrigerate them for up to 2 to 3 days. If you have more than you can eat, consider freezing them! Just wrap them in plastic wrap and aluminum foil, or place them in an airtight container. They can last up to 2 months in the freezer.
How can I make these sliders healthier?
For a healthier twist, consider using whole wheat slider rolls instead of traditional white ones. Additionally, opt for a light Greek yogurt-based ranch dressing and reduce the cheese. Buffalo Chicken Sliders
Equipment
- Oven
- Baking sheet
- Mixing Bowl
- Parchment paper
Ingredients
Buns and Fillings
- 1 package Hawaiian sweet dinner rolls such as King’s Hawaiian
- 3 cups shredded chicken breast about 8 ounces cooked
- ¾ cup hot sauce such as Frank’s RedHot or Frank’s Buffalo
- ¼ cup ranch dressing I use a Greek-yogurt based
- 1 teaspoon garlic powder
- 2 cups shredded mozzarella or provolone, or Havarti cheese, divided
- 3 tablespoons unsalted butter melted
- 1 teaspoon Italian seasoning
Instructions
Preparation
- Place a rack in the center of your oven and preheat to 375°F. Line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
- Without disconnecting the buns at their sides, slice the slider buns in half horizontally. Place the bottom half in the center of the baking sheet.
- In a mixing bowl, combine the chicken, Buffalo sauce, ranch dressing, and garlic powder.
- Scatter a small handful of the cheese on the bottom buns, then top evenly with the Buffalo chicken. Sprinkle the remaining cheese evenly over the top.
- Place the top bun over the chicken. In a small bowl, combine the melted butter and Italian seasoning, then brush liberally over the top of the buns.
- Bake the Buffalo chicken sliders until the cheese is melty and the tops are golden, about 10 to 12 minutes. Transfer to a cutting board and let cool a few minutes. Carefully slice apart with a serrated knife, and serve.
